<LIFE'S HAPPY DAYS>: (25) A MEAGRE DINNER: — The fish was good, but it's far too dear on the bill... thirty nine francs for a meagre dinner!... — This restaurant owner's a heretic... he breaks one of the most Christian precepts: thou shalt not eat expensively on Fridays!...
Date | 1844 |
---|---|
Materials and Techniques | lithograph |
Size(cm) | 23.2 x 22.7 |
Inscriptions | Signed on the stone, lower left: h. D.; Numbered on the stone, lower left of center: 665 |
Standard ref. | Delteil 1112 (ii/ii), Tobu II-338 |
Category | Prints |
Collection Number | G.2000-1060 |
Provenance
Peter Morse; Tobu Museum of Art (Tobu Railway Company); Purchased by the NMWA, 2001.
